Weight Watchers Beef Noodle Soup recipe

Course Soup
Cuisine Chinese
Servings 6

Ingredients

  • 1 lb cubed beef stew meat
  • 1 cup chopped onions
  • 1 cup chopped celery
  • 1/4 cup beef bouillon granules
  • 1/4 teaspoon dried parsley
  • 1 pinch ground black pepper
  • 1 cup chopped carrots
  • 5 3/4 cups water
  • 2 1/2 cups frozen egg noodles

Instructions

  • In a large saucepan over medium high heat, saute the stew meat, onion and celery for 5 minutes, or until meat is browned on all sides.
  • Stir in the bouillon, parsley, ground black pepper, carrots, water and egg noodles.
  • Bring to a boil, reduce heat to low and simmer for 30 minutes.

How many Weight Watchers points in beef noodle soup recipe?
WW POINTS per serving: 8
Nutritional information per serving: 343 calories, 20.3g fat, 1.7g fiber
